Abstract
The utility model discloses a sintering ignition device for automatically clearing tar in a gas pipe. The sintering ignition device comprises the gas pipe, a branch gas pipe connected with the gas pipe, a valve on the branch gas pipe, an ignition gas pipe connected with the valve, a gas regulating valve connected with the ignition gas pipe, and a burner connected with the gas regulating valve, wherein the branch gas pipe and the ignition gas pipe are respectively provided with a steam heater. The sintering ignition device disclosed by the utility model can be used to clear the tar in the gas pipe on line under the condition of not stopping the operation of a sintering machine, in addition, the sintering ignition device is not in contact with gas, does not trigger each component of an ignition furnace, is safe and is convenient to operate, and thus, the operation efficiency is improved, and safety accidents are prevented.

Background technology
Autumn and winter, because environment temperature is lower, so the coal tar in coke-stove gas easily is set in gas piping inwall or gas valve place, blocking pipe, and because its viscosity is larger, cause not easy-clear.
At present, the igniting of sintering machine is ignition media mainly with coke-stove gas.After the coal tar blocking pipe, gas pressure is descended and affect ignition quality, if will not with timely processing, can affect the normal production of sintering machine.Coal tar in the removing pipeline, usually adopt the method for leading to nitrogen or steam blowing after coal gas of cutting off, and must carry out after cutting off sintering machine production at present, namely carries out off-line and remove, and affects the operating efficiency of unit.And, because coke-stove gas contains toxic gas, also can cause security incident as misoperation.

The specific embodiment
Be described further below in conjunction with accompanying drawing:
A kind of can self-cleaning the sintering ignition device of tar in gas pipe, the branch gas tube 2 that comprises gas pipe 1, is connected with gas pipe 1, the valve 3 on branch gas tube 2, the ignition coal tracheae 4 that is connected with valve 3, the gas regulator 5 that is connected with ignition coal tracheae 4, the burner 6 that is connected with gas regulator 5.It all is equipped with steam heater 7 on branch gas tube 2 and ignition coal tracheae 4.
Described steam heater 7: by the gas pipe through hole 9 of processing on case shell 8, case shell 8, adopt welding with case shell 8 or the steam that is threaded enter manage 10 and steam drain 11 form.
For reducing heat waste, be bonded with heat-insulation layer 12 on case shell 8 inwalls.
Be to install, convenient disassembly, case shell 8 can be designed to by the shape that forms of the semicircle gas pipe through hole 15 of processing respectively on case shell 1 and case shell 2 14, case shell 1 and case shell 2 14, case shell 1 and case shell 2 14 are symmetric figure; And be welded to connect plate 16 respectively on case shell 1 and case shell 2 14, the processing screw hole 17 on connecting plate 16; A side between case shell 1 and case shell 2 14 adopts latch to connect, and opposite side is fixed by the bolt in screw on the connecting plate 16 of packing into 17.
For further preventing heat waste, all be bonded with sealing strip 18 in the junction of case shell 1 and case shell 2 14.
In use, steam is passed into, make steam and branch gas tube 2 and ignition coal tracheae 4 by the heat transmission, tar be melted and taken out of pipeline by coal gas.
